In 1842, Royal Peter (Nathan) Sheffield entered the world in Aurora, Kane, Illinois, USA, born to Nathan Newberry John Sheffield And Maria Celestia Peter Stolp. In 1850, Royal Peter (Nathan) Sheffield resided in Frankfort, Will, Illinois, USA. In 1860, Royal Peter (Nathan) Sheffield resided in Lafayette, Story, Iowa. Royal Peter (Nathan) Sheffield married Moneve Sheffeld, Parmelia Morenilva Squirer, and had children including Alzina Lillian Royal Sheffield, Ava T Royal Sheffeld, Clinton Anson Royal Sheffield, Edgar Royal Sheffield Eol, Edson Royal Sheffield Eol, Eva Pauline Royal Sheffield, Frank Squier Royal Sheffield, Nettie Augusta Royal Sheffield, Royal P Royal Shiffield, Scott Cleveland Royal Shiffield, Stella Eva Royal Sheffield. Royal Peter (Nathan) Sheffield passed away in 1932 in Story City, Iowa, USA.
